Start your day by visiting the magnificent Nohkalikai Falls, which is one of the tallest waterfalls in India. Take a scenic drive through the lush green hills to reach the falls. Spend the morning enjoying the breathtaking views of the waterfall and surrounding landscapes. In the afternoon, take a short hike to the viewpoint for some amazing photo opportunities. In the evening, head back to Shillong for a relaxing evening in the city.
Start your day with a visit to Mawsmai Cave, a natural wonder formed by limestone with beautifully lit stalactites and stalagmites. Spend the morning exploring the various chambers of the cave and admiring its natural beauty. In the afternoon, head to the nearby living root bridges, another natural marvel of the region. In the evening, return to Shillong for a relaxing night in the city.
Take a scenic drive to Dawki in the morning and enjoy a boat ride on the crystal clear waters of the Umngot River. Admire the stunning views of the surrounding hills and the riverbed. After the boat ride, you can enjoy a picnic lunch by the river. In the afternoon, visit the Bangladesh border viewpoint for some panoramic views of the border and surrounding hills. In the evening, return to Shillong for a relaxing evening.
Start your day early and head to the village of Tyrna, the starting point of the trek to the Double Decker Living Root Bridge. The trek takes around 3-4 hours each way, passing through lush forests and breathtaking scenery. Spend the day trekking and enjoying the natural beauty of the area. In the evening, return to your hotel for a relaxing evening.
Spend your final day in Shillong relaxing and exploring the city at your own pace. You can visit some of the local markets, museums, and cafes in the morning. In the afternoon, head to Ward's Lake for a relaxing boat ride on the lake. In the evening, head to Shillong Peak for a panoramic view of the city and surrounding hills. Relax and enjoy the cool breeze and beautiful sunset.
If you have extra time, you can consider visiting the Mawphlang Sacred Forest, Elephant Falls, or the Don Bosco Museum. You can also plan a side trip to Cherrapunji or Mawlynnong, which are both known for their scenic beauty and unique culture.
